Convert a block to a source arrow
1 Click the Convert Block To Source Arrow tool on the Conver-
sion toolbar.
2 Select your non-AutoCAD Electrical source block and/or any
text related to it that you might want to map to the new
AutoCAD Electrical source.
3 Select the wire end for the source arrow.
4 Define the Source Signal Code and click OK.
5 Define attribute values.
Convert a block to a destination arrow
1 Click the Convert Block To Destination Arrow tool on the
Conversion toolbar.
2 Select your non-AutoCAD Electrical destination block and/or
any text related to it that you might want to map to the new
AutoCAD Electrical destination.
3 Select the wire end for the destination arrow.
4 Define the Destination Signal Code and click OK.
5 Define attribute values.
Overview of ECDS legacy conversion
For this conversion to be effective, AutoCAD Electrical must have information
to intelligently swap AutoCAD Electrical type blocks with the blocks used on
your ECDS drawings. It also must know how to map the values carried on
each attribute on the blocks. This information is all supplied in an Access
database file called WDVIACMP.MDB.
